带备份的Btrfs快照

时间:2015-04-21 23:46:56

标签: rsync zfs btrfs

有没有办法通过在第一次备份时复制整个磁盘备份btrfs文件系统,然后复制快照文件而不是使用rsync(或者这是一个坏主意)?

1 个答案:

答案 0 :(得分:2)

你绝对可以这样做,虽然rsync会在新系统上复制一些块。

您可能对Buttersink感兴趣。 ButterSink就像rsync,但对于btrfs子卷而不是文件,这使得它更有效地存档备份快照。它建立在btrfs发送和接收功能之上。源和目标可以是本地btrfs文件系统,SSH上的远程btrfs文件系统或S3存储桶。

例如,以下内容将仅将快照差异复制到远程计算机,并在那里创建快照的高效镜像:

buttersink /home/snaps/  ssh://backup-server/bak/snaps/